40 /* Duplicates headers of loops if they are small enough, so that the statements
41 in the loop body are always executed when the loop is entered. This
42 increases effectiveness of code motion optimizations, and reduces the need
43 for loop preconditioning. */
45 /* Check whether we should duplicate HEADER of LOOP. At most *LIMIT
46 instructions should be duplicated, limit is decreased by the actual
47 amount. */
49 static bool
50 should_duplicate_loop_header_p (basic_block header, struct loop *loop,
51 int *limit)
53 gimple_stmt_iterator bsi;
54 gimple last;
56 /* Do not copy one block more than once (we do not really want to do
57 loop peeling here). */
58 if (header->aux)
59 return false;
61 /* Loop header copying usually increases size of the code. This used not to
62 be true, since quite often it is possible to verify that the condition is
63 satisfied in the first iteration and therefore to eliminate it. Jump
64 threading handles these cases now. */
65 if (optimize_loop_for_size_p (loop))
66 return false;
68 gcc_assert (EDGE_COUNT (header->succs) > 0);
69 if (single_succ_p (header))
70 return false;
71 if (flow_bb_inside_loop_p (loop, EDGE_SUCC (header, 0)->dest)
72 && flow_bb_inside_loop_p (loop, EDGE_SUCC (header, 1)->dest))
73 return false;
75 /* If this is not the original loop header, we want it to have just
76 one predecessor in order to match the && pattern. */
77 if (header != loop->header && !single_pred_p (header))
78 return false;
80 last = last_stmt (header);
81 if (gimple_code (last) != GIMPLE_COND)
82 return false;
84 /* Approximately copy the conditions that used to be used in jump.c --
85 at most 20 insns and no calls. */
86 for (bsi = gsi_start_bb (header); !gsi_end_p (bsi); gsi_next (&bsi))
88 last = gsi_stmt (bsi);
90 if (gimple_code (last) == GIMPLE_LABEL)
91 continue;
93 if (is_gimple_debug (last))
94 continue;
96 if (is_gimple_call (last))
97 return false;
99 *limit -= estimate_num_insns (last, &eni_size_weights);
100 if (*limit < 0)
101 return false;
104 return true;
107 /* Checks whether LOOP is a do-while style loop. */
109 static bool
110 do_while_loop_p (struct loop *loop)
112 gimple stmt = last_stmt (loop->latch);
114 /* If the latch of the loop is not empty, it is not a do-while loop. */
115 if (stmt
116 && gimple_code (stmt) != GIMPLE_LABEL)
117 return false;
119 /* If the header contains just a condition, it is not a do-while loop. */
120 stmt = last_and_only_stmt (loop->header);
121 if (stmt
122 && gimple_code (stmt) == GIMPLE_COND)
123 return false;
125 return true;
128 /* For all loops, copy the condition at the end of the loop body in front
129 of the loop. This is beneficial since it increases efficiency of
130 code motion optimizations. It also saves one jump on entry to the loop. */
132 static unsigned int
133 copy_loop_headers (void)
135 loop_iterator li;
136 struct loop *loop;
137 basic_block header;
138 edge exit, entry;
139 basic_block *bbs, *copied_bbs;
140 unsigned n_bbs;
141 unsigned bbs_size;
143 loop_optimizer_init (LOOPS_HAVE_PREHEADERS
144 | LOOPS_HAVE_SIMPLE_LATCHES);
145 if (number_of_loops () <= 1)
147 loop_optimizer_finalize ();
148 return 0;
151 #ifdef ENABLE_CHECKING
152 verify_loop_structure ();
153 #endif
155 bbs = XNEWVEC (basic_block, n_basic_blocks);
156 copied_bbs = XNEWVEC (basic_block, n_basic_blocks);
157 bbs_size = n_basic_blocks;
159 FOR_EACH_LOOP (li, loop, 0)
161 /* Copy at most 20 insns. */
162 int limit = 20;
164 header = loop->header;
166 /* If the loop is already a do-while style one (either because it was
167 written as such, or because jump threading transformed it into one),
168 we might be in fact peeling the first iteration of the loop. This
169 in general is not a good idea. */
170 if (do_while_loop_p (loop))
171 continue;
173 /* Iterate the header copying up to limit; this takes care of the cases
174 like while (a && b) {...}, where we want to have both of the conditions
175 copied. TODO -- handle while (a || b) - like cases, by not requiring
176 the header to have just a single successor and copying up to
177 postdominator. */
179 exit = NULL;
180 n_bbs = 0;
181 while (should_duplicate_loop_header_p (header, loop, &limit))
183 /* Find a successor of header that is inside a loop; i.e. the new
184 header after the condition is copied. */
185 if (flow_bb_inside_loop_p (loop, EDGE_SUCC (header, 0)->dest))
186 exit = EDGE_SUCC (header, 0);
187 else
188 exit = EDGE_SUCC (header, 1);
189 bbs[n_bbs++] = header;
190 gcc_assert (bbs_size > n_bbs);
191 header = exit->dest;
194 if (!exit)
195 continue;
197 if (dump_file && (dump_flags & TDF_DETAILS))
198 fprintf (dump_file,
199 "Duplicating header of the loop %d up to edge %d->%d.\n",
200 loop->num, exit->src->index, exit->dest->index);
202 /* Ensure that the header will have just the latch as a predecessor
203 inside the loop. */
204 if (!single_pred_p (exit->dest))
205 exit = single_pred_edge (split_edge (exit));
207 entry = loop_preheader_edge (loop);
209 if (!gimple_duplicate_sese_region (entry, exit, bbs, n_bbs, copied_bbs))
211 fprintf (dump_file, "Duplication failed.\n");
212 continue;
215 /* If the loop has the form "for (i = j; i < j + 10; i++)" then
216 this copying can introduce a case where we rely on undefined
217 signed overflow to eliminate the preheader condition, because
218 we assume that "j < j + 10" is true. We don't want to warn
219 about that case for -Wstrict-overflow, because in general we
220 don't warn about overflow involving loops. Prevent the
221 warning by setting the no_warning flag in the condition. */
222 if (warn_strict_overflow > 0)
224 unsigned int i;
226 for (i = 0; i < n_bbs; ++i)
228 gimple_stmt_iterator bsi;
230 for (bsi = gsi_start_bb (copied_bbs[i]);
231 !gsi_end_p (bsi);
232 gsi_next (&bsi))
234 gimple stmt = gsi_stmt (bsi);
235 if (gimple_code (stmt) == GIMPLE_COND)
236 gimple_set_no_warning (stmt, true);
237 else if (is_gimple_assign (stmt))
239 enum tree_code rhs_code = gimple_assign_rhs_code (stmt);
240 if (TREE_CODE_CLASS (rhs_code) == tcc_comparison)
241 gimple_set_no_warning (stmt, true);
247 /* Ensure that the latch and the preheader is simple (we know that they
248 are not now, since there was the loop exit condition. */
249 split_edge (loop_preheader_edge (loop));
250 split_edge (loop_latch_edge (loop));
253 free (bbs);
254 free (copied_bbs);
256 loop_optimizer_finalize ();
257 return 0;
